Sharpness at 10mm
Our sharpness tests were conducted using a 42-megapixel Sony A7R II body mounted to a tripod. The camera’s shutter release was also set on a timer-delay to avoid any possible camera shake. The test subject was shot using ambient lighting, hence some colour and contrast variation is to be expected between apertures.
The full frame at 10mm
Centre sharpness is impressively high throughout the entire aperture range, with peak performance between f/5.6-f/16. Corner sharpness is also good, producing optimal sharpness at f/11-f/16.
